Barack and Michelle Close to Signing Record-Breaking Deal Worth Over $60 MILLION For Memiors
Daily Mail ^ | 17:49 EST, 28 February 2017 | Chris Spargo

Posted on 02/28/2017 4:10:04 PM PST by drewh

Barack and Michelle Obama have whipped the literary world into a frenzy with the news that the former president and first lady are getting to work on new books, and looking for a publisher. Multiple people with knowledge of the joint publishing deal currently on the table for global rights to both memoirs tell the Financial Times that bidding has already surpassed $60million in what is described as the 'most hotly anticipated deal of the year.' And that amount could grow as there are no shortage of interested publishing houses, with Simon & Schuster, Macmillan, Harper Collins and Penguin Random House said to be interested in the deal. It is Penguin however who appears to have the slight edge, having published Barack's three previous titles.

There is no release date for either of the memoirs, but news of who will be securing the rights could come as early as Tuesday evening. That would mean the Obamas 'yuuuuge' deal might be announced just as President Trump prepares to address a joint session of Congress for the first time in office. There is also a chance however that it could take weeks to finalize the deal. No matter how long it takes however, no book deal has ever come close to paying an author this much money, with the closest example being the the $150million James Patterson reportedly received from Hachette in 2009 as part of a 17-book deal. That breaks down to a little less than $10million a book, as opposed to he $30million Barack and Michelle each stand to make in their deal.
